If the contract is silent as to its term and termination, then the Court will likely imply a term to the effect that the contract can be terminated on reasonable notice.

Acceptance by silence may occur in a contract to perform services if one party offers to do a service and the other party does not reply or take any action. This might be taken as acceptance of the offer and the formation of a legally enforceable contract.
The untimely acceptance of an offer. Such an acceptance is not valid although it does have the legal status of a counteroffer. The general rule is that silence does not constitute acceptance.
An MSA (which can also be called a managed services contract, or a management service agreement) is an agreement between a managed services provider (MSP) and a client. The contract defines which services the MSP will provide, the minimum amount of time for a response, payment structure, and liability protection.
If youre ready to terminate your service agreement, you should be sure to do so in writing. You can either send an email to your service provider or compose a termination letter on business stationery. You should sign this notification using both your official title and the name of your company.
Use a termination clause. If your contract has a termination clause, you can follow the steps stipulated in it to release yourself from the contract. Generally, a termination clause will stipulate that due notice of termination must be given in writing for termination to be acceptable.
